On Monday we checked out the exisiting laundry and how Naomi transformed it from unused space with a single set of taps and a tub to a gorgeous second bathroom, complete with toilet and massive shower.
Today, we’ve got the very first of the room reveals where Naomi shows off the finished product from 4 weeks of hard slog. Also on site is Colleen, the real estate agent who originally valued the property (and has managed the lease for the past few years) and Stuart Zadel from Zadel Property Education.
Colleen, who originally valued the property at around $800k, is getting her first glimpse of the new and refreshed exterior and interiors. Naomi walks Colleen and Stuart through the entry way and primary living space and we’re given a flashback to how it looked initially and how its been transformed.
